Individual Details

Richard J. WOULFE

(5 May 1843 - 25 May 1927)

Richard arrived in the United States from Ireland as a young child and went on to become a prosperous farmer and horse breeder in Illinois. According to his obituary in the Kerry News edition of 5 December 1927, he and his wife, Kate, "were both second and third cousins". I have figured out that Richard and Kate were second cousins once removed through Richard's father and Kate's mother (whose maiden name was Woulfe), but I have so far been unable to come up with a second connection.
